00:21The Trump administration's AI initiative plans were leaked via a GitHub repository before it
00:27was taken down, revealing a strategy to integrate AI across federal operations.
00:32The project, led by the General Services Administration's Technology Transformation Services, aims to
00:38automate federal work and includes components like a chatbot and an API for agencies to connect
00:44with AI models from major firms.
00:47In related developments, a recent demonstration of Tesla's full self-driving mode raised safety
00:52concerns as it repeatedly failed to stop for a school bus, hitting child-sized mannequins
00:57during tests conducted by anti-Tesla organizations.
01:01This incident has prompted discussions about the readiness of fully autonomous vehicles, especially
01:06with the upcoming rollout of Tesla's CyberCab being delayed due to safety apprehensions.
01:12The Trump organization has also launched a mobile phone service called Trump Mobile, featuring
01:18a monthly plan priced at $47.45, and a smartphone set to debut in September for $499.
01:26The service includes unlimited talk, text, and data, along with additional benefits, while
01:31raising ethical concerns due to its licensing agreements and higher pricing compared to established
01:37carriers.
01:39Academics are drawing parallels between the launch of chat GPT and atomic bomb tests, suggesting
01:45that the proliferation of AI models may lead to a contamination of data quality, potentially
01:50causing AI model collapse.
01:52They advocate for the creation of clean data sources, akin to low background steel, to ensure
01:57the reliability and competitiveness of future AI systems.

02:32In technological advancements, Soong Zhu, an engineer with minimal experience in 3D printing
02:39and CAD, has successfully designed and built a 3D-printed winged VTOL drone that can fly for
02:45130 miles.
02:47The project took 90 days and involved creating components from scratch, showcasing the integration
02:52of advanced battery technology and innovative design principles.
02:56New York State lawmakers have passed the RAISE Act, aimed at preventing AI models from contributing to large-scale
03:04disasters.
03:05The bill mandates transparency standards for major AI labs, and requires them to report
03:10safety incidents, with penalties for non-compliance.
03:13Advocates believe this legislation is crucial for AI safety, despite pushback from the tech industry.
03:19DARPA's Persistent Optical Wireless Energy Relay Program has achieved new milestones in wireless
03:26power transmission, successfully beaming 800 watts over a distance of 5.3 miles.
03:33This innovative technology aims to revolutionize power supply for military and humanitarian operations
03:39by using laser beams to deliver energy, without the need for traditional power lines.
03:44Google has introduced a feature in its search results that allows users to generate AI podcasts
03:51summarizing search results through a new audio overview experience.
03:55This feature, currently in testing, enables users to listen to a conversation between two
04:00AI voices discussing the search results, with playback options and source listings included.
04:07Finally, the FIA is considering implementing fees for companies seeking launch and re-entry licenses
04:12to support its commercial space office amid the industry's rapid growth.
04:17Proposed legislation would phase in these fees over eight years, with funds allocated to cover
04:21operational costs, as the number of commercial space operations has surged significantly in
04:26recent years.
